# Cypher

Cypher條件判斷如何使用IN操作符

小樊
82
2024-10-31 23:44:29

在Cypher查詢語(yǔ)言中,`IN`操作符用于篩選滿足某個(gè)屬性的多個(gè)值的節(jié)點(diǎn) 假設(shè)我們有一個(gè)名為`Person`的節(jié)點(diǎn)類型,它具有屬性`name`和`age`。我們想要查詢所有年齡為25歲、30歲或4...

0

在Cypher查詢語(yǔ)言中,您可以使用邏輯運(yùn)算符來(lái)組合和評(píng)估條件 1. AND(與):用于連接兩個(gè)或多個(gè)條件,當(dāng)所有條件都為真時(shí),結(jié)果為真。 ``` MATCH (n) WHERE n.propert...

0

在Cypher查詢語(yǔ)言中,您可以使用比較運(yùn)算符來(lái)構(gòu)建條件判斷 1. 等于(==):檢查兩個(gè)值是否相等。 ``` MATCH (a:Person {name: 'Alice'}) WHERE a.ag...

0

在Neo4j中,Cypher是一種用于查詢圖形數(shù)據(jù)庫(kù)的語(yǔ)言 1. 使用`WITH`子句: 在查詢中使用`WITH`子句可以將數(shù)據(jù)分組到一個(gè)臨時(shí)結(jié)果集中。然后,您可以使用聚合函數(shù)(如`SUM()`,...

0

在Cypher查詢語(yǔ)言中,您可以使用`REGEXP`操作符進(jìn)行正則表達(dá)式匹配 ```cypher MATCH (n) WHERE n.property REGEXP 'pattern' RETURN...

0

在Cypher查詢語(yǔ)言中,可以使用`CAST()`或`TO`關(guān)鍵字進(jìn)行類型轉(zhuǎn)換 1. 使用`CAST()`函數(shù): ```cypher SELECT CAST(property AS STRING)...

0

在Neo4j中,Cypher是一種用于查詢圖形數(shù)據(jù)庫(kù)的語(yǔ)言 1. 使用`SUM()`函數(shù)進(jìn)行數(shù)值求和: ``` MATCH (n) RETURN SUM(n.property) AS total_...

0

在Apache Cypher中,您可以使用`COLLECT()`和`TIME_TO_STR()`等聚合函數(shù)來(lái)處理日期 假設(shè)您有一個(gè)名為`Event`的節(jié)點(diǎn),其中包含一個(gè)名為`event_date`的...

0

在Neo4j中,Cypher是一個(gè)用于查詢圖形數(shù)據(jù)庫(kù)的聲明式語(yǔ)言 1. 使用`COLLECT`函數(shù)收集節(jié)點(diǎn)的屬性值: ```cypher MATCH (n) RETURN COLLECT(n.pr...

0

在Cypher中,你可以使用`WITH`子句和聚合函數(shù)(如`COLLECT`、`SUM`、`AVG`等)進(jìn)行嵌套聚合。以下是一個(gè)示例,展示了如何在查詢中進(jìn)行嵌套聚合: 假設(shè)我們有一個(gè)名為`Sales...

0